Hoặc
14 câu hỏi
Vận dụng 2 trang 148 Tin học 10. Để kiểm thử một chương trình, nếu chỉ bằng việc kiểm tra thông qua các bộ dữ liệu test thì có bảo đảm tìm ra hết lỗi của chương trình hay không? Vì sao?
Vận dụng 1 trang 148 Tin học 10. Chương trình sau có chức năng sắp xếp một dãy số cho trước. Hãy kiểm tra xem chương trình có lỗi không? Nếu có thì tìm và sửa lỗi. A = [10,1,5,2,8,0,4] for i in range (len(A)-1). j = i while j > 1 and A[j] < A[j-1]. A[j], A[j-1] = A[j-1], A[j] j = j – 1 print (A)
Luyện tập 2 trang 148 Tin học 10. Chương trình sau có lỗi không? Nếu có thì tìm và sửa lỗi. m = input (“Nhập số tự nhiên m. ”) n = input (“Nhập số tự nhiên n. ”) print (“Tổng hai số đã nhập là. ”, m + n)
Luyện tập 1 trang 148 Tin học 10. Chương trình của em khi chạy phát sinh lỗi ngoại lệ ZeroDivisionError. Đó là lỗi gì và em xử lí lỗi này như thế nào?
Hoạt động trang 145 Tin học 10. Tìm hiểu một số phương pháp kiểm thử chương trình Đọc và thảo luận nhóm các phương pháp, công cụ sau để biết chức năng, tác dụng của từng công cụ trong công việc kiểm thử chương trình.
Khởi động trang 145 Tin học 10. Bài học trước em đã biết khái niệm lỗi ngoại lệ khi chạy chương trình Python. Tuy nhiên, một chương trình chạy khong có lỗi ngoại lệ (chương trình không bị dừng) thì không có nghĩa là chương trình không có lỗi. Thậm chí các “lỗi” không tường minh này (các lỗi này được gọi bug) càng khó phát hiện và khó sửa. Theo em, làm thế nào để kiểm tra (test) và gỡ lỗi (debug) m...
Câu 4 trang 116 Tin học 10. Có thể xem giá trị các biến sau khi thực hiện một câu lệnh ở đâu?
Câu 3 trang 116 Tin học 10. Có bao nhiêu nhóm dữ liệu khác nhau cần tạo ra để kiểm thử chương trình?
Câu 2 trang 116 Tin học 10. Tại sao phải tạo nhiều bộ dữ liệu vào khác nhau để kiểm thử chương trình?
Câu 1 trang 116 Tin học 10. Em hãy nêu một vài lỗi thuộc nhóm lỗi cú pháp và một vài lỗi thuộc nhóm lỗi ngữ nghĩa.
Vận dụng trang 116 Tin học 10. Em hãy soạn thảo chương trình dưới đây, sau đó áp dụng biện pháp theo dõi từng bước thực hiện chương trình để quan sát sự thay đổi của các biến
Hoạt động 2 trang 112 Tin học 10. Tại sao rất khó phát hiện lỗi nếu chỉ dùng biện pháp đọc kĩ lại chương trình?
Hoạt động 1 trang 110 Tin học 10. Trong những phần trước, các bài tập và bài thực hành không quá phức tạp. Đã lần nào em soạn chương trình và thực hiện được ngay từ lần đầu tiên chưa?
Khởi động trang 110 Tin học lớp 10. Có những chương trình còn lỗi vì khi thực hiện cho ra kết qua sai. Theo em, việc biết giá trị của một số biến ngay sau khi mỗi câu lệnh được thực hiện có thể giúp tìm ra lỗi của chương trình hay không?
86.7k
53.8k
44.8k
41.7k
40.3k
37.5k
36.5k
35.3k
34k
32.5k